Thin Provisioning Maximize disk drive usage without accurately knowing required capacity (Small Start) No need to change logical volume sizes when disk drives are added Save on both initial and ongoing costs. For better ROI Thin Provisioning Able to allocate logical volume capacity greater than physical disk capacity of storage system Server Virtual volumes (Logical volume of 50TB) Physical disk pool (Disk pool of 10TB) Added disk drives Write Write data Threshold amount to warn Unallocated capacity Threshold warning Add disk drives Write Allocated capacity System administrator Logical capacity matches future requirements Physical capacity matches current requirements No need to change logical volume sizes when disk drives are added. 10TB are enough for 1 year ahead, but need 50TB 5 years from now ETERNUS disk storage system 19
Eco-mode Eco-mode with MAID technology (MAID: Massive Arrays of Idle Disks) Schedule spin-stop period by setting timing for selected drives Auto spin-down if there is no access to selected drives for more than 30 minutes (variable) Access to the specified drive is about one minute Eco-mode conserves energy and costs Backup window 12 on am off 5 12 pm off Data Volume Back-up Volume All Back-up Volume drives are ON only for five hours 20
